The Benefits of Using Creosote Round Fence Posts
When it comes to constructing a durable fence, the choice of materials can significantly impact both the longevity and effectiveness of the structure. One popular option that has stood the test of time is creosote round fence posts. Known for their exceptional resilience and effectiveness, these posts offer numerous advantages for property owners looking to enhance their boundaries.
Creosote, a wood preservative derived from the distillation of coal tar, has been utilized for centuries due to its ability to protect wood from decay, insects, and harsh environmental conditions. Creosote-treated wood posts are particularly valued in fencing applications because they can withstand the rigors of outdoor exposure much better than untreated wood. This treatment extends the life of round fence posts, making them an economical choice in the long run, despite the higher initial investment compared to untreated timber.
One of the primary benefits of creosote round fence posts is their durability. These posts can last for several decades without significant degradation, effectively resisting rot and damage from pests such as termites and ants. This resilience is essential for farmers and landowners who rely on strong, sturdy fencing to contain livestock or delineate property lines. Fences are a critical aspect of farm management, and using creosote posts ensures that investment in fencing won’t need to be repeated frequently.

Another advantage of creosote round fence posts is their natural aesthetic appeal. The round shape offers a rustic charm that complements rural landscapes and enhances the overall appearance of outdoor spaces. Whether used in agricultural settings or residential backyards, these posts blend seamlessly into the environment, providing both functionality and visual appeal.
Additionally, creosote round posts offer excellent stability and strength. The rounded design minimizes the risk of snagging and provides a strong support base for various types of fencing materials, be it barbed wire, electric fencing, or wooden panels. This structural integrity is crucial, as it helps maintain the fence’s effectiveness against wind pressure and other environmental stressors.
It’s worth noting that, while creosote offers numerous benefits, some individuals may have concerns regarding its chemical properties. However, when used correctly and responsibly, creosote-treated posts can safely be incorporated into many fencing projects. For those worried about potential environmental impacts, alternative wood treatments and materials are available, but they may not provide the same level of durability.
